Now that conventional 3% down loans are a reality, buyers have a real alternative to FHA. While the FHA loan has its benefits, it comes with high upfront fees and permanent mortgage insurance.

The 3 percent down payment program is limited to loan sizes of $ 484,350 or less. Loans in high-cost areas are permitted, but loan sizes remain capped at local conforming loan limits .

3% Down Payment Program. Conventional loans will have PMI if there is less than 20% downpayment/equity. There are no up-front fees added to the loan and the PMI varies based on credit scores, the amount of down-payment and other factors.
